As Thanksgiving approaches, I’m thinking about how my smart home setup can help make this holiday more enjoyable and stress-free! :cupcake::sparkles: Here are a few tips and tricks I’ve picked up along the way that might inspire you to create a seamless and festive celebration:

  1. Automated Decorations - I’ve set up my smart lights to switch to warm, amber tones in the evenings, creating a cozy ambiance without lifting a finger. For the Thanksgiving table, consider adding timed color changes or preset scenes that match the mood of your gathering.

  2. Smart Lighting for Entertaining - Motion sensors in the entryway ensure guests are greeted with a warm welcome, while dimmable table lamps let you adjust the lighting based on the activity—bright for dinner, softer for dessert and conversation.

  3. Security and Monitoring - With family and friends arriving, it’s reassuring to have my security cameras and doorbell monitor system up and running. I can keep an eye on things from my phone while still enjoying the festivities.

  4. Energy Management - Using my smart plugs and energy monitors, I’ve scheduled my appliances to run during off-peak hours, saving energy and reducing costs. It’s a small detail, but it adds up!

  5. Entertainment Automation - I’ve linked my music system to the calendar, so it starts playing a Thanksgiving playlist as soon as guests arrive. It’s a fun way to set the tone without needing to manually start the music.
